The postcode M28 6PP is located in Salford, in the county of Greater Manchester. It was introduced in January 1980 and terminated in May 1994.M28 6PP is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).
M28 6PP is one of the most de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 0.5 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of M28 6PP as Hard-pressed living > Migration and churn > Hard-pressed ethnic mix.
The closest road name to M28 6PP is Wingate Road which is centered 23 m away.
The nearest bus stop is Manchester Road East and is 76 m away. The closest railway station is Walkden Rail Station, 1.53 km away.
The closest primary school to M28 6PP (for ages 11 and under) is St Edmund's RC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on September 22, 2021.
Policing for M28 6PP is covered by the Greater Manchester police force association and Salford is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
